Palace Regarding Jokowi-Megawati Meeting: Open President In Continuation With Anyone

JAKARTA - Presidential Special Staff Coordinator Ari Dwipayana said President Joko Widodo (Jokowi) was open to meeting anyone. Moreover, a figure who is a national figure.

Ari conveyed this in response to the opportunity for a meeting between Jokowi and PDIP General Chair Megawati Soekarnoputri during the moment of Eid al-Fitr.

"The president is very open to keeping in touch with anyone, especially with national figures," Ari told reporters, Friday, April 12.

Even so, Ari said the meeting between the two was still waiting for the right time. However, he believes that the moment of Eid can be used to strengthen the relationship.

"Regarding the relationship with Mrs. Megawati, the right time is being sought. After all, this is still in Syawal. The month of Syawal is the most appropriate month to strengthen friendship," he said.

As previously reported, President Jokowi performed Eid al-Fitr prayers at the Istiqlal Mosque and held an open house on the first day of Eid al-Fitr 1445 Hijri on Wednesday, April 10. He was not seen at Megawati Soekarnoputri's residence at that time.

In fact, the 5th President of the Republic of Indonesia received many guests including ministers such as Minister of Finance (Menkeu) Sri Mulyani, Minister of Foreign Affairs (Menlu) Retno Marsudi, to Minister of Energy and Mineral Resources Arifin Tasrif. The relationship between Jokowi and Megawati has reportedly stretched recently.

One of the reasons is suspected because Jokowi supports Prabowo Subianto running with his eldest son, Gibran Rakabuming Raka in the 2024 presidential election. Meanwhile, PDIP carries former Central Java Governor Ganjar Pranowo and former Coordinating Minister for Political, Legal and Security Affairs Mahfud MD.
